Of course the most obvious influence that I used was in River’s generation where I decided that much like Bridget Jones’ Diary is a retelling of Pride and Prejudice that I would retell a classic novel with River’s generation. In that case the book chosen was Middlemarch by George Eliot. River is of course Dorthea while Conrad is Casaubon and Will is Wil Ladislaw. In less subtle ways though, Sense and Sensibility was also an influence regarding the relationship between River and Parker. With Parker actually acting as Elinor and being protective of River or who in this case was Marianne. I’ve also had a few movies as inspiration. I accidentally stole a line from Tangled with Kennedy.
